1. Understanding SlimLipo
SlimLipo is a minimally invasive procedure that uses laser energy to melt fat cells and tighten the skin. It is typically used to address areas such as the abdomen, thighs, and arms. The procedure is known for its precision and relatively quick recovery time, making it a favored choice among those seeking body contouring.
2. Factors Influencing Frequency of Treatments
The frequency of SlimLipo treatments can vary based on several factors:
- Individual Response: Each person's body reacts differently to the procedure. Some may achieve their desired results with one treatment, while others may require multiple sessions.
- Amount of Fat: The amount of fat to be removed can influence the number of treatments needed. Larger areas or higher fat deposits may require more sessions.
- Skin Elasticity: Skin that is more elastic may respond better to SlimLipo, potentially requiring fewer treatments.
- Lifestyle and Diet: Maintaining a healthy lifestyle and diet post-treatment can help sustain results and reduce the need for frequent treatments.
3. Recommended Time Between Treatments
It is generally recommended to wait at least 3-6 months between SlimLipo treatments. This period allows the body to heal and for the full effects of the procedure to be observed. Waiting ensures that the skin and tissues are adequately prepared for subsequent treatments, reducing the risk of complications.

5. Safety Considerations
Safety is paramount when considering the frequency of SlimLipo treatments. Overdoing the procedure can lead to complications such as skin damage, infection, or uneven results. It is crucial to consult with a qualified and experienced practitioner who can assess your individual needs and guide you on the appropriate treatment schedule.

FAQ
Q: How long do the results of SlimLipo last?
A: The results of SlimLipo can be long-lasting, especially with a healthy lifestyle. However, factors such as weight gain and aging can affect the longevity of the results.
Q: Is SlimLipo painful?
A: SlimLipo is generally well-tolerated. Most patients experience minimal discomfort, and any pain is usually managed with local anesthesia and post-operative pain medication.
Q: Who is a good candidate for SlimLipo?
A: Good candidates for SlimLipo are individuals who are within 30% of their ideal body weight, have good skin elasticity, and have localized areas of fat that are resistant to diet and exercise.
Q: Are there any side effects of SlimLipo?
A: Common side effects include temporary swelling, bruising, and discomfort. More serious complications are rare but can include infection, skin damage, and uneven results.
